Tasting Notes


This 2012 Chateau Ducru Beaucaillou from Bordeaux, France exudes elegance and complexity. The deep ruby red color allures with its shimmering hues. On the nose, the aromas of dark cherries, black currants, and cedar envelop the senses, with a hint of tobacco and vanilla lingering in the background. On the palate, the wine is full-bodied and velvety, with a perfect balance of tannins and acidity. Flavors of ripe blackberries, plums, and a touch of spice add depth and richness to this wine. The finish is long and smooth, leaving a lasting impression of finesse and sophistication. This vintage showcases the typical characteristics of Chateau Ducru Beaucaillou, with its bold yet refined nature. It is a true representation of the terroir and craftsmanship of this esteemed estate. Enjoy now or cellar for a few more years for added complexity.
